

A memorial service will be held on Thursday, March 27, 2014 at 10am at Beth-El Congregation in Fort Worth, TX and a graveside service will take place at 2pm at the Temple Beth-El Memorial Park on the Austin Hwy in San Antonio, TX, on Friday, March 28, 2014.
She was born in New Orleans, LA on May 5, 1918. She became a San Antonio, TX resident in 1938 and so remained for 68 years before moving to Fort Worth, TX in 2001. Mrs. Brooks was a member of Temple Beth-El in San Antonio and a member of Congregation Beth-El in Fort Worth.
Mrs. Brooks was very active in both religious and philanthropic organizations, former presidents of Temple Beth-El Sisterhood, Women's Auxiliary to Goodwill Industries and the Pan Hellenic organization, board member and active member of multiple San Antonio philanthropies.
Mrs. Brooks survived her daughter, Gaye Anne Brooks Felder, her son, Bernard M. Brooks, Jr. and her grandson, Jason Matthew Hiney. Her survivors include her granddaughter and grandson-in-law, Jude A. and Marc E. Sloter of Fort Worth, TX, their children, Mollie, Caroline and Stewart, her grandson and granddaughter-in-law, Bret M. and Kristine Brooks of Shakopee, MN and their children, Taylor, Kaylee, Blake and Blane, grandson Bernard M. Brooks, III, daughter-in-law, Sherry E. Brooks of Dallas, TX, and son-in-law, David W. Felder of San Antonio, TX.
In lieu of flowers, memorial contributions may be made to Beth-El Congregation in Fort Worth, Temple Beth-El in San Antonio or Jewish Children's Regional Service in Metairie, LA.
